Merry and Bright by Debbie Macomber

Merry Knight has been quite busy with her job and family while getting ready for the upcoming Christmas season so she hasn’t put any time into starting any kind of a social life. As an early present Merry’s mother and brother decided that they would sign her up for an online dating service when she kept using the I don’t have any time excuse. Merry isn’t sure about getting out there and dating but doesn’t have the heart to be mad at her family for thinking of her happiness.

Jayson Bright hears about the online dating service from a friend who is now a very happy customer and planning his own wedding. A bit skeptical Jayson hesitantly signs on to check out the service and immediately sees Merry’s new account and decides to take a chance and message her. The two of them quickly become friends behind their computer screens chatting away with one another night after night but when the time comes to meet there’s quite a big obstacle that just may keep them apart.

Merry and Bright by Debbie Macomber was a lovely little Christmas romance read that is sure to put a smile on your face and bring in those festive thoughts as the holiday season approaches. Merry was born near the Christmas holiday hence her festive spelling of her name and has always loved the season and everything it brings. Jayson however is the Scrooge in the story who never had the lovely memories of Christmas that Merry had so it was nice to see how her influence brightened his spirit.

While Merry and Jayson were both likable and true to their character descriptions and fun getting to know I think what made this story even more touching was Merry’s family. While the family is a close knit loving bunch Merry’s brother sometimes stole the show as he helped Merry with finding a date. Her brother was special needs and I felt like the character was wonderfully portrayed in the story and loved him interacting with Merry and Jayson. In the end it was a lovely little feel good Christmas romance and I’d definitely recommend checking this one out.
